oqLiq Debuts Spring/Summer 2027 “RESONANCE” During London Fashion Week

Taiwan-based contemporary fashion label oqLiq debuted its Spring/Summer 2027 collection, RESONANCE, today as part of the London Fashion Week September 2026 Digital Schedule. The presentation premiered at 2:15 PM BST in London and 9:15 PM GMT+8 in Taipei.

Rooted in the continuous exchange between nature, material and the body, RESONANCE considers how clothing can respond intuitively to the environments we move through. Inspired by the constant shifts of wind, water, light, temperature and humidity, the collection approaches the garment as an interface between the wearer and their surroundings.

That relationship comes to life through the collection’s digital presentation, which places the wearer within a surreal, elemental landscape where nature and constructed space continually intersect. Against deep blue skies, still bodies of water, and vast mineral formations, the solitary model moves through scenes that shift between intimacy and monumental scale. Fabric appears to echo the movement of wind, while clouds, rock formations, and reflective surfaces create a visual world that blurs the boundaries between landscape and architecture. Close-up imagery of the face and eye brings the perspective back to the body, establishing a visual rhythm between the individual and the environment surrounding them.

The result is a world that feels simultaneously natural and imagined, extending the collection’s exploration of adaptation, movement, and sensory awareness. Rather than functioning simply as a backdrop, the environment becomes part of the collection’s narrative, reinforcing the idea that the body is continuously sensing and responding to change.

The Spring/Summer 2027 collection reflects the idea of clothing becoming instinctive and familiar—the piece a wearer repeatedly reaches for as they move through everyday life.

This collection brings together SUPIMA® cotton, wool and other natural-fibre blends with functional textiles, selected in response to different climates and the movement of the body. Natural fibres and technology coexist throughout the garments, balancing seemingly opposing qualities including lightness and protection, dryness and moisture, softness and structure. As the wearer moves through changing environments, the materials are designed to respond alongside them.

Visually, the collection reduces color to a singular tonal field, directing attention toward construction rather than surface decoration. Lines move across the body to shape volume, movement and form, while precise pattern cutting, functional construction and considered material choices define the garments. In the digital presentation, that restraint allows the collection to sit quietly against the dramatic scale of its surroundings, bringing silhouette, texture and movement to the forefront.

Through RESONANCE, oqLiq continues to explore clothing as an interface between the body and its environment, something capable of receiving, transmitting and adapting to change. As both the body and the city remain in constant motion, the garments move alongside them, offering functionality and protection while maintaining an understated presence.

ABOUT oqLiq

oqLiq is a Taiwan-based contemporary fashion label working at the intersection of functional textiles, urban wear and responsible design. Beginning with the body and everyday life, oqLiq uses technical materials, innovative pattern cutting and a restrained visual language to create clothing where function exists naturally within the wearing experience. From climate and movement to contemporary urban life, oqLiq continues to explore how clothing can respond to its environment while accompanying the body that lives and moves within it.
